How much do member engagement man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 7, 2026, the average yearly pay for member engagement manager in Spring, TX is $69,231.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$48,100.00 and $83,600.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

How does a member engagement manager typically collaborate with other departments to enhance member experience?

A Member Engagement Manager works closely with teams such as marketing, customer service, and product development to design and implement initiatives that improve member satisfaction and retention. Regular cross-functional meetings are common to ensure alignment on engagement strategies, gather feedback, and address member needs promptly. This collaboration enables the development of targeted campaigns, personalized communications, and responsive support, all of which contribute to an outstanding member experience.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a member engagement manager?

To thrive as a Member Engagement Manager, you need expertise in member relations, project management, and data-driven decision-making, often supported by a bachelor's degree in business, communications, or a related field. Familiarity with CRM platforms, email marketing tools, and analytics systems is typically required to manage and assess engagement strategies. Outstanding interpersonal skills, creativity, and proactive communication help build strong relationships and foster member loyalty. These abilities are crucial for driving member satisfaction, retention, and overall organizational growth.

What is the difference between Member Engagement Manager vs Community Manager?

AspectMember Engagement ManagerCommunity Manager
CredentialsTypically requires a bachelor's degree in marketing, communications, or related fields; certifications in community engagement or digital marketing are common.Similar educational background; certifications in social media management or community engagement are often preferred.
Work EnvironmentWorks within organizations like nonprofits, associations, or membership-based companies focusing on member retention and engagement.Operates in online or offline communities, social media platforms, and event settings to foster community interaction.
Employer & Industry UsageCommonly employed by membership organizations, nonprofits, and corporate entities with a focus on member relations.Used across industries including tech, entertainment, and nonprofits to manage online communities and brand loyalty.

While both roles focus on fostering engagement, the Member Engagement Manager primarily concentrates on strengthening relationships with members through strategic initiatives, whereas the Community Manager often manages broader online or offline communities, emphasizing interaction and brand building.

What does a member engagement manager do?

A Member Engagement Manager is responsible for developing and implementing strategies to increase member participation, satisfaction, and retention within an organization. They often manage communications, organize events, and gather feedback to better understand member needs. Their goal is to foster a strong relationship between the organization and its members, ensuring that members feel valued and engaged. This role may be found in associations, nonprofits, clubs, and other membership-based organizations.

Is a member engagement manager a good career?

A member engagement manager is a role focused on building relationships and increasing participation within organizations or communities. It often requires strong communication, interpersonal skills, and familiarity with engagement tools or platforms. The career can be rewarding for those interested in community development and customer relations, with opportunities for advancement into leadership positions.
